The cheapest way to get from Edinburgh to Capenhurst is to drive which costs £55 - £85 and takes 4h 11m.
The fastest way to get from Edinburgh to Capenhurst is to drive which takes 4h 11m and costs £55 - £85.
No, there is no direct train from Edinburgh to Capenhurst. However, there are services departing from Edinburgh Waverley and arriving at Capenhurst via Warrington Bank Quay and Chester.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 16m.
The distance between Edinburgh and Capenhurst is 241 miles. The road distance is 230.7 miles.
The best way to get from Edinburgh to Capenhurst without a car is to train which takes 4h 16m and costs £40 - £130.
It takes approximately 4h 16m to get from Edinburgh to Capenhurst, including transfers.
Edinburgh to Capenhurst train services, operated by Avanti West Coast, depart from Edinburgh Waverley station.
The best way to get from Edinburgh to Capenhurst is to train which takes 4h 16m and costs £40 - £130. Alternatively, you can fly, which costs £80 - £200 and takes 5h 50m.
Edinburgh to Capenhurst train services, operated by Avanti West Coast, arrive at Warrington Bank Quay station.
Yes, the driving distance between Edinburgh to Capenhurst is 231 miles. It takes approximately 4h 11m to drive from Edinburgh to Capenhurst.
What companies run services between Edinburgh, Scotland and Capenhurst, Cheshire, England?
Avanti West Coast operates a train from Edinburgh Waverley to Warrington Bank Quay every 4 hours. Tickets cost £35–120 and the journey takes 2h 48m. Alternatively, easyJet, Ryanair, and Aer Lingus fly from Edinburgh Airport (EDI) to Liverpool (LPL) 3 times a day.
